Just an advance warning to anyone intending to travel by train to Woking on March 7th.
Because of engineering work between Retford and Peterborough all trains from Doncaster to London will be diverted causing 90 minutes to be added to the journey. This applies also to the return journey. eg, if you were going on the 8.34 from Town Station you wont arrive in Woking till 14.33.
Anyone going via Lincoln- Newark, you will be bussed from Newark to Peterborough so an extra 90 minutes also.
